Ability Costs & Value Analysis
Understanding the economy of Murder Duels is crucial for efficient progression. Abilities are purchased using in-game coins, and prices vary significantly based on utility and power. Some abilities are cheap and accessible, while top-tier utilities like the Ricochet Bullet or Portal can cost upwards of 12,000 to 20,000 coins.

Below is a breakdown of the cost tiers to help you plan your Murder Duels buying strategy.
| Ability Name | Estimated Cost | Role | Value Rating |
|---|---|---|---|
| Triple Knife | Low | Lineup / Area Denial | ★★★☆☆ |
| Full Auto Gun | Low | Close Range / Spam | ★★☆☆☆ |
| Smoke | Low | Obscurity / Cover | ★☆☆☆☆ |
| Quick Reload | Medium | DPS / Burst | ★★★☆☆ |
| Molotov | Medium | Zone Control | ★★★★☆ |
| Sprint | Medium | Movement / Positioning | ★★★★☆ |
| Ricochet Bullet | High (12k+) | AoE / Multi-Target | ★★★★★ |
| Explosive Knife | High (20k) | Burst Damage | ★★★★☆ |
| Portal Knife | High (20k) | Mobility / Escape | ★★★★★ |
| Updraft | High (20k) | Verticality | ★★★★★ |
Expensive abilities like the Portal Knife and Updraft require significant coin investment. Avoid buying these early if you are struggling with basic aiming mechanics, as they rely heavily on game sense to utilize effectively.
Top Tier Ability Combos
Buying individual abilities is only half the battle; combining them correctly creates win conditions. Certain synergies elevate your gameplay significantly, turning standard utilities into devastating tools.
The Fly High Combo
- Portal Knife + Updraft
- Effect: Throw the portal high and activate Updraft to launch yourself vertically.
- Use Case: Excellent for escaping low-ground fights or getting "high ground" advantage for easy eliminations.
- Difficulty: Hard
The Ricochet Molly
- Ricochet Bullet + Molotov
- Effect: Fire a bullet that bounces off walls into enemies standing in fire.
- Use Case: Locking down choke points in 4v4 modes where enemies are grouped.
- Difficulty: Medium
The Clutch King
- Deflect + Quick Reload
- Effect: Stun an attacker who misses their shot, then instantly reload to finish them.
- Use Case: 1v1 scenarios where you need to turn the tide quickly.
- Difficulty: Medium
The Deflect ability is arguably the strongest defensive tool in the game. If you find yourself constantly losing duels, prioritize buying Deflect over offensive items. It stuns the opponent, leaving them vulnerable to a counter-attack.
Step-by-Step Buying Guide
If you are new to the game or looking to optimize your coin spending, follow this progression path. It ensures you get the most bang for your buck without wasting coins on underwhelming utilities.
Start with Essentials
Begin by purchasing Triple Knife or Full Auto Gun. These are low-cost options that help you learn the fundamentals of throwing and shooting without draining your bank account.
Unlock Mobility
Save coins to unlock Sprint or Molotov. Movement and zone control are vital for intermediate play. The Molotov, in particular, deals high damage (20 ticks) and forces enemies out of position.
Invest in High Tier
Once you have mastered movement, save up for the Ricochet Bullet. This ability is a game-changer in 4v4 modes, allowing you to damage multiple enemies with a single trigger pull.
Master Advanced Tech
The final step of your Murder Duels buying journey is acquiring Portal Knife and Updraft. This combo requires practice but offers the highest skill ceiling for aerial plays and unpredictable movement.

While the Icy Bullets ability slows enemies, it generally deals less damage. For most players, prioritizing raw damage or movement (Ricochet/Portal) is more effective than the slow effect. Stick to the meta abilities for climbing the leaderboards.
Utility & Support Abilities
Not every purchase needs to be about raw damage. Some abilities provide information or deception, which can be just as valuable in the right hands.
| Ability | Function | Best Scenario | Rating |
|---|---|---|---|
| Decoy | Creates a fake clone | Confusing enemies in 1v1s | ★★★☆☆ |
| Wall Hack | See enemies through walls | Peeking corners safely | ★★★★☆ |
| Smoke | Creates visual cover | Reviving teammates / Escaping | ★★☆☆☆ |
| Icy Bullets | Slows target on hit | 4v4 Crowd Control | ★★☆☆☆ |
The Wall Hack ability is highly underrated. If you are struggling with players peeking you, buying Wall Hack allows you to pre-fire corners, giving you a massive time-to-kill advantage.
FAQ
Q: What is the best ability to buy first in Murder Duels?
For beginners, the **Triple Knife** or **Full Auto Gun** are the best starting purchases due to their low cost. For intermediate players with saved coins, the **Ricochet Bullet** is the single best upgrade for your loadout.
Q: Is the Portal and Updraft combo worth the high cost?
Yes, the **Portal + Updraft** combo is worth the investment. It allows for unmatched vertical mobility, letting you escape bad fights or take the high ground for easy kills. However, it requires practice to master the timing.
Q: How do I get coins fast for buying expensive abilities?
The most efficient way to earn coins is by maintaining win streaks. As seen in high-level gameplay, a 33+ win streak yields significant rewards. Focus on using free or cheap abilities until you have enough bankrolled for the 20k items.
Q: Should I buy the Deflect ability?
Absolutely. **Deflect** is a top-tier defensive tool. It stuns an opponent if they shoot at you while it is active, giving you a free kill. It is highly recommended for players who want to win 1v1 duels consistently.
